Visit to Railway Support Services, Wishaw

A visit has been arranged to this site (near Birmingham, not the Wishaw in Scotland!) on Saturday 15th August, starting at 10:00. It is the base for a fleet of hired diesel shunters, as well as a number of stored locos and items of railway rolling stock. Although this is one of the few sites today that will tolerate private individual visits, the main advantage of this group visit is that the normally locked shed containing some of the ex-LT Schöma/Claytons will be opened for inspection. The owner, Andrew Goodman, will also be on-hand and will be happy to answer any questions about the rail hire business, or his involvement with the heritage sector and his steam locos.
